Hi all,
I'm getting an odd reading from my megger 1552,when trying a zs it is showing >500 and the fuse symbol is showing.
I have got new fuses,with the same result.
Has the tester somehow got fried from greater than 500volts?

Have you checked meter on another circuit or installation just incase you dont have a cpc connection.

Try it with 2 leads between L & N that should give reading if not meter probably fried.
 
Noticed it on the last job,changed the fuse,and still the same on this job.
Still giving out voltage readings and resistance.just zs and rcd tests it doesnt like.
 
Just to let you all know.
The tester had fried wire from the internal battery supply.
Fixed by Calmet in kingston upon thames,for £165.........at Christmas.......doh.
Still,at least it ain't a new tester!
Happy new year all...
 
My m8 had the same problem about 2 months ago, the meter was well out of warranty phoned Megger they said it would be an internal fuse. As the meter was out of warranty we tried to get into the meter to change the fuse got it open a crack but to no avail so frustrating as I could see all 4 quick blow fuses just out of fingers reach. Anyway got a quote from SIS in Brooklands £265+ vat and a 2 week wait just went out and bought a new one.
